3. REPORT OF DECISIONS FROM MEETING HELD ON MAY 18, 2011

i. Certificate of Appropriateness for Exterior Alterations; 24 City Center (Lower H.H. Hay Bldg.); J. B. Brown & Sons, Applicant. The Board voted 5-0 (Hammen and Wroth absent) to approve the application, subject to conditions.

ii. Preliminary Review of Proposed Porch Roof Addition; 97 State Street; Gary’s House, Applicant. This item was tabled, as the applicant did not attend the meeting.

ii. Certificate of Appropriateness for Exterior and Site Alterations; 25 Vaughan Street; Sally and Ted Oldham, Applicant. The Board voted 4-0 (Hammen and Wroth absent, Oldham recused) to approve the application, subject to conditions.
